Genie Industries, a business segment of the Terex Corporation, is headquartered in Bothell, WA with branch offices worldwide; we manufacture material lifts, aerial work platforms, trailer-mounted booms and light towers, telehandlers, scissor lifts and self-propelled telescopic and articulating booms. We are a company with a strong safety first mentality, team based culture, respect for the individual and high integrity. This position is located in Redmond, WA.
Role Purpose
The Senior Manufacturing Engineer - Design for Automation (DFA) is responsible for enabling automation‑ready, scalable, and repeatable manufacturing solutions for Genie products by leading DFA efforts upstream through New Product Development (NPD) and supporting robust execution across Manufacturing Engineering and Manufacturing Technical Services (MTS).
This senior‑level role serves as a recognized technical authority for automation‑critical manufacturing processes, ensuring Genie products are designed for efficient, low‑risk global production and aligned with Terex Factory of the Future (FOF) objectives. The role bridges Design Engineering, Plant Manufacturing Engineering, and MTS, providing technical leadership to reduce variation, cost, and downstream automation risk.
Responsibilities
Design for Automation (DFA) - NPD & Upstream Enablement
* Lead and own Design for Automation (DFA) activities through Genie NPD phase gates and prior to design freeze, ensuring automation capability is designed in rather than retrofitted downstream.
* Provide senior‑level technical influence on product and process design including weldments, assemblies, interfaces, tolerances, materials, and part presentation to enable scalable automation across Genie global plants.
* Evaluate and apply DFA principles to major Engineering Change Orders (ECOs) where automation risk, manufacturability impact, or cost opportunity exists.
* Act as a key technical partner to Design Engineering, providing clear recommendations on automation readiness, manufacturability, and total cost of ownership.
Manufacturing Engineering
Lead the design, development, and optimization of manufacturing processes using a combination of automation, robotics, and efficient manual operations.
* Provide senior level engineering support for complex production issues, serving as an escalation point for automation‑related challenges.
* Support and technically lead product line transfers, startups, and process duplication in partnership with global Genie plants and MTS sending/receiving teams.
* Translate engineering designs into robust production solutions, including layouts, equipment sequencing, tooling strategies, and process definitions suitable for global deployment.
Manufacturing Process SME Ownership
* Serve as a Subject Matter Expert (SME) for automation‑critical manufacturing processes including welding, assembly, tooling/fixturing, material handling and critical torquing.
* Define and own automation‑capable process requirements, technical criteria, and design constraints aligned with Genie and Terex standards.
* Lead or provide expert support for PFMEAs, CTQs, and manufacturing capability reviews, ensuring automation risks are identified and mitigated early.
DFA Standards, Governance & Factory of the Future
* Develop, maintain, and govern Genie DFA standards, rules, and guidelines, ensuring consistent application across platforms and plants.
* Establish and enforce governance for automation‑related design decisions, documenting standards and best practices for reuse across Genie product lines.
* Actively support Genie process automation initiatives by enabling repeatable, scalable, and transferable manufacturing and automation solutions.
* Apply Lean Manufacturing, continuous improvement, and structured problem‑solving methodologies to drive improvements in safety, quality, delivery, and cost.
